With the flatfly build, you can get more debugging info to find out what's wrong as follows:

try to run it while holding down the SHIFT key. In the resulting console, type 'electrum' and hit Enter.
Do you get any error messages?

Try to same test with typing 'python'

I don't have Python installed. I thought these are standalone clients?

Nothing after 1.6.2 works. The shift key does not help, the client does not even start. There is no console. The process shows for a second in taskmanager, then goes away.

The official clients do the same thing, up to 1.8.1, whether standalone or installed.

Are these all 64bit versions???

I know this is old, but  I've had the same problem, and found a fix that worked for me:

1) Close electrum
2) Go to C:\Users\-your username-\AppData\Roaming\Electrum
3) Find 'config' file.
4) Rename or remove config file
5) Open Electrum

This worked for me - worth a try.
